NaviLibrary
I have been thinking about a new game project for some time. One important first step was to include mouse support and a decent user interface. Thanks to a nice little piece of code called NaviLibrary this was quite easy. Basically youre using Google Chrome as your GUI so anything you can do on a website is available in your user interface.
